GEORGE R. BOGGS is president and CEO emeritus of the American Association of Community Colleges and superintendent/president of Palomar College in San Marcos, California. An active author and speaker, Boggs is the recipient of many awards and honors including the Public Broadcasting System's Terry O'Banion Prize for Teaching and Learning for "triggering the most significant educational movement of the past decade."
CHRISTINE J. MCPHAIL is the managing principal for the McPhail Group LLC, a higher education consulting firm, former president of Cypress College, emerita professor of higher education and founder of the Community College Leadership Doctoral Program at Morgan State University, and a coach for Achieving the Dream, a national nonprofit reform network dedicated to community college student success and completion. She is a recipient of the AACC National Leadership Award and the League for Innovation in the Community College Terry O'Banion Leadership Award. McPhail is the editor of one of AACC's best-selling publications, Establishing and Sustaining Learning Centered Community Colleges.
PRACTICAL LEADERSHIP IN COMMUNITY COLLEGES
Practical Leadership in Community Colleges is an essential resource for leaders who must meet the myriad challenges community colleges face every day. Grounded in field observations, reports, news coverage, and interviews with leaders and policymakers, this important text offers a clear examination into the issues confronting college leaders and provides clear direction for managing through difficult times.
Written by former college presidents, including a past president of the American Association of Community Colleges, Practical Leadership in Community Colleges is a real-world guide to more effective management methods and contains practical insight and expert perspective.
The authors cover a broad range of issues including managing the ups and downs of the economic cycle, dealing with performance-based funding legislation, increasing college completion ratios, calls for accountability from both the public and the government, and much more.
There are no one-size-fits-all answers for addressing these complex issues or responding to cases, but Practical Leadership in Community Colleges can help prepare leadership teams for the inevitable difficult issues they will face as they lead these dynamic institutions that are so important to our society.
